Book excerpt: Limited evidence suggests that the chemical reactivity of tailings is in fact inhibited by storage underwater, and that such storage may be a preferred long-term disposal option. To assess the long-term environmental feasibility of subaqueous disposal of mine tailings, this report examines the waters and sediments of the south basin of Buttle Lake, B.C. (the site of an inactive submerged tailings deposit). The copper, zinc and lead-rich mine tailings were deposited in the lake via a submerged outfall from 1966-84. The tailings are widespread across the basin and are being covered by a thin veneer of natural sediments. The report presents a detailed study of the distributions of metals in both the solid phases and interstitial waters of the sediments, and in the overlying surface waters.

Book excerpt: This study constitutes the initial stage in assessing Benson Lake's recovery from tailing disposal from the Benson Lake Coast Copper Mine, which operated from 1962 to 1973 in northern Vancouver Island. In 1967 and 1973 fish were found to have high levels of zinc in tissues, although equal levels were also found in a nearby control lake. At that time the entire lake bottom was covered by tailings and devoid of benthic life, and the outlet river had a layer of fines on the bottom.

Book excerpt: This project was a collaborative project between the Marine Institute (MI) in Galway and Radiation and Environmental Science Centre (RESC) in the Dublin Institute of Technology (DIT). In Ireland, at present, sediment quality assessments are generally reliant on chemical analysis alone with limited bioassay techniques available to further characterise the sediment. Some causative agents of toxicity to biological organisms are below analytical detection limits. Integration of bioassay data with chemical analysis is essential in order to complete a full ecotoxicological assessment of the quality of the marine environment. This project describes the chemical analysis of marine sediment for persistent pollutants from selected locations around the coast of Ireland. A novel analytical technique is developed for extraction and quantification of organotins (OTCs) from sediment and for subsequent exposure onto fish cell lines. Fish cell cultures are additionally exposed to a range of reference OTC chemicals. The method for organotin extraction is additionally utilised in a Toxicity Identification Evaluation study whereby a crude solvent extract is assayed on two biological organisms namely the Microtox (employing the marine bacterium Vibrio fischeri) and the marine copepod Tisbe battagliai and chemically analysed. A further fractionation of the extract is then performed and further testing conducted on the organisms, therefore potentially pinpointing the source of toxicity. An in-situ study using caged Nucell lapillus and Crassostrea gigas to monitor TBT induced bioeffects in Irish harbours was also developed which was correlated with stable isotope ratios, condition indices and measurement of OTCs in the various biota tissues and sediment samples. This short term exposure methods showed a rapid development of imposex in gastropod species and shell abnormalities in oysters at a TBT polluted location.

Book excerpt: Confronted by mounting community opposition to big new mines in the Asian Pacific, the mining industry is promoting a relatively untested technology to keep toxic wastes out of sight and mind. STD (submarine tailings disposal) shifts the increasing burden of toxic mine-wastes from land to the Pacific Ocean floor. The practice started in Papua New Guinea, spread to Indonesia, and is now threatening the Philippines and islands of the South Pacific. Its chief proponents are Canadian, Australian, and British mining companies that would not be allowed to use the technology in their home countries. Farmers and fisherpeople have registered vocal protests against STD, but, so far, their voices have largely been ignored. This book describes and critiques the process, referring extensively to its dubious record and recent community experiences of its use.
